1. Geometric Canvas Art
Creating geometric canvas art is a fantastic way to add a modern and stylish touch to any room. You can use painter’s tape to create various shapes and patterns on a blank canvas, then fill in the shapes with your choice of colors. This project is not only simple but also customizable to match any decor.
2. Botanical Prints
Botanical prints are a timeless and elegant addition to any home. You can create your own by pressing flowers and leaves between sheets of wax paper, then framing them. This project brings a touch of nature indoors and can be a lovely reminder of your favorite outdoor spaces.
3. String Art
String art is a playful and creative way to add texture and dimension to your walls. Start by outlining a design on a wooden board using small nails, then weave colorful string around the nails to create your desired pattern. The possibilities are endless, from abstract designs to personalized names or shapes.
4. Abstract Watercolor Paintings
Abstract watercolor paintings are perfect for adding a splash of color and creativity to your space. Simply use watercolor paints to create freeform designs on watercolor paper, then frame your artwork. This project is especially great for those who enjoy experimenting with color blending and brush techniques.
5. Fabric Wall Hangings
Fabric wall hangings are a great way to introduce texture and warmth to your home. You can create your own by cutting fabric into various shapes and sizes, then sewing or gluing them onto a wooden dowel. Hang your creation on the wall for a cozy and bohemian vibe.
6. Photo Collage
Creating a photo collage is a wonderful way to display your favorite memories and moments. Arrange printed photos in a grid or random pattern on a large piece of poster board, then frame and hang it on your wall. This personalized piece of art is sure to be a conversation starter.
7. DIY Macrame
Macrame wall hangings are a trendy and intricate way to decorate your walls. There are plenty of tutorials available online to get you started with basic knots and patterns. Once you get the hang of it, you can create beautiful and elaborate designs to adorn your home.
8. Painted Wood Slices
Wood slices are a rustic and natural canvas for your artwork. You can paint them with various designs, such as mandalas, animals, or abstract patterns. These painted wood slices can be hung individually or arranged in a cluster for a unique and earthy wall display.
9. Embroidery Hoop Art
Embroidery hoop art is a charming and delicate way to add handmade decor to your walls. Stretch fabric tightly over an embroidery hoop, then use embroidery floss to create your desired design. This project is perfect for adding a touch of whimsy and craftsmanship to any room.
10. Repurposed Window Frames
Old window frames can be transformed into beautiful and rustic wall art. You can paint the frames and use them to display photos, prints, or even as a backdrop for small shelves. This project is a great way to give new life to old materials and add character to your home.
Project | Materials Needed | Difficulty Level |
---|---|---|
Geometric Canvas Art | Canvas, painter’s tape, paints | Easy |
Botanical Prints | Flowers, leaves, wax paper, frames | Easy |
String Art | Wooden board, nails, string | Intermediate |
Abstract Watercolor Paintings | Watercolor paints, watercolor paper | Easy |
Fabric Wall Hangings | Fabric, wooden dowel, glue/sewing kit | Intermediate |
Photo Collage | Printed photos, poster board, frame | Easy |
DIY Macrame | Macrame cord, dowel | Intermediate |
Painted Wood Slices | Wood slices, paints | Easy |
